About Garry McMichael

Garry McMichael

For three decades Garry McMichael has been traveling the back roads of Middle America, especially the Ozarks and the Mississippi River basin, capturing its beauty with the camera, charcoals, pastels and paint. Garry is constantly searching for those fleeting moments when the landscape, the atmospheric conditions and the ever-changing light come together in a flash of visual inspiration. Whether you are inspired by the ebb and flow of the Mississippi River, a quiet walk through the rugged Ozark mountains, or watching a summer thunderstorm roll across the prairie you will appreciate the art of Garry McMichael.
